Chat with us, powered by LiveChat Perform form validation Manipulate form fields - Wridemy

Perform form validation Manipulate form fields

Objectives: Perform form validation

Manipulate form fields

Requirements: Download orderform.html for this lesson.

Add a link to the jQuery library and the external JavaScript file to the html page.

Put the cursor in the username field

Add validation to the form fields whenever the user moves off the form field as follows:

Name – required – non-blank

Email – required, valid email address (use regex)

Address & City, Shipping Address & city – required – non-blank

Zip code, Shipping zip code – required, numeric, 5 characters

If an error is found, display an appropriate error message in the associated span error tag beside the field.

If no error is found, set the text of the error field to nothing (to remove any previously displayed error messages).

When the user changes the Copy address checkbox:

If the checkbox is checked, copy the billing address, city and zip to the corresponding shipping fields

Add an entry to the state dropdown list as selected with the state from the billing state dropdown list.

When the user moves off of a quantity control (class =”qty”):

Initialize an ordertotal to 0

For each quantity:

get the quantity value entered. If it is not numeric, change it to 0

get id to use to identify the associated price and total

get the price text by using the id “price” + the index value

multiply price times quantity to get a total

Put the total in the table cell with id “total”+index

Add the total to the ordertotal

Place the order total in the subtotal cell.

If ship state is “TX”, calculate tax of .08 times the total and put in the tax cell. Use 0 for all other states.

Add tax to ordertotal.

Calculate shipping based on the shipping state and place it in the shipping cell.:

“TX”: $5.00

“CA” & “NY”: $20

all others: $10

Add shipping to the ordertotal

Display the ordertotal in the Grand Total cell.

When the form is submitted, revalidate all the fields. If the data is not valid, cancel submission of the form.

Our website has a team of professional writers who can help you write any of your homework. They will write your papers from scratch. We also have a team of editors just to make sure all papers are of HIGH QUALITY & PLAGIARISM FREE. To make an Order you only need to click Ask A Question and we will direct you to our Order Page at WriteDemy. Then fill Our Order Form with all your assignment instructions. Select your deadline and pay for your paper. You will get it few hours before your set deadline.

Fill in all the assignment paper details that are required in the order form with the standard information being the page count, deadline, academic level and type of paper. It is advisable to have this information at hand so that you can quickly fill in the necessary information needed in the form for the essay writer to be immediately assigned to your writing project. Make payment for the custom essay order to enable us to assign a suitable writer to your order. Payments are made through Paypal on a secured billing page. Finally, sit back and relax.

Do you need an answer to this or any other questions?

About Wridemy

We are a professional paper writing website. If you have searched a question and bumped into our website just know you are in the right place to get help in your coursework. We offer HIGH QUALITY & PLAGIARISM FREE Papers.

How It Works

To make an Order you only need to click on “Place Order” and we will direct you to our Order Page. Fill Our Order Form with all your assignment instructions. Select your deadline and pay for your paper. You will get it few hours before your set deadline.

Are there Discounts?

All new clients are eligible for 20% off in their first Order. Our payment method is safe and secure.

Hire a tutor today CLICK HERE to make your first order